The San Jos City Council consists of ten Councilmembers elected by district and a Mayor elected at-large each for four-year terms. The Mayor and Council are responsible for representing the residents of San Jos providing accountability reviewing public policy and programs and adopting those policies which best meet the needs of the residents visitors and businesses in San Jos.


The Office of Councilmember Peter Ortiz (District 5) is seeking a dedicated and dynamic Council Policy and Legislative Advisor to join a high-performing and community-centered team. This role offers the opportunity to engage directly with residents shape local policy and contribute meaningfully to initiatives that uplift East San Jos.


The Council Policy and Legislative Advisor position will provide administrative constituent services and legislative support for an elected official. This position requires a unique blend of policy acumen community engagement skills and the ability to manage multiple priorities at once. The position typically requires researching and responding to inquiries from residents; drafting written communications involving strategy policies and/or procedures on behalf of the elected official; and serving as the representative of the elected official regarding certain functions. These duties require an employee with strong and effective organizational skills; ability to handle multiple assignments; excellent written and oral communications skills and the ability to develop and maintain effective and collaborative working relationships with community members and neighborhood organizations key stakeholders and City staff.


Ideal candidates are solutions-oriented thoughtful under pressure and bring a high level of initiative empathy and follow-through. The position is well-suited for someone who thrives in a fast-paced collaborative and mission-driven environment and who understands that effective public service often extends beyond traditional office hours. Candidates must be willing to work evenings and weekends as needed and as exempt management employees are not eligible for overtime compensation.
